Field Location: West Texas / New Mexico Project Based Office Location: Odessa, TX Type: Full Time General Information/Job Summary Provide on-site technical and administrative management for Electrical and Instrumentation (E&I) phases on industrial construction projects including the development and management of an E&I team. Owners/clients are typically leading companies in the power generation/transmission, mining/material handling, Oil & Gas, and manufacturing industries. Responsibilities/Competencies Assume overall responsibility for a profitable, well-constructed, safe project, completed in a timely manner Review project proposal and pertinent documents with project team and Director of Operations Determine the most cost-effective construction methods and use of personnel, material, equipment, and subcontractors Review and approve subcontractor selections and invoicing Coordinate construction activities with the owner, subcontractors, and Company personnel Manage project staff, including assigned support staff, superintendents, project general foreman, and assistants Promote, enforce, and establish safety as a priority as part of the Company's management philosophy Ensure that management is accurately and fully informed of project costs as compared to budgets through weekly labor and monthly budget reports Coordinate and provide direction for the budget estimating, purchasing, engineering, accounting, cost, and construction functions as they relate to the completion of the project. Initiate, establish and maintain working relationships with owner, engineers, suppliers, and subcontractors to facilitate construction activities Organize, conduct, and represent the company at project coordination meetings at regular agreed upon intervals. Review and approve subcontractor, vendor payment applications and miscellaneous invoices Negotiate, prepare, issue, and execute change orders (proposals) to owners, design team, subcontractors, and others, and prepare revisions to original budget because of changes and revisions to work. Ensure timely and accurate billings and accounts receivables. Ensure timely project completion through project scheduling, expediting of material deliveries and the management of material and document submittals/approvals. Lead and participate in regularly schedule project staff meetings Manage Closeout process Enforce and adhere to all Policies and Processes as it relates to this position Actively participates on internal team(s) that focus on continuous improvement of the business. Requirements 3 plus years of experience managing large instrument and electrical construction, heavy industrial projects in Oil and Gas. Demonstrated success in management of construction projects Possess working knowledge of all projects plans, specifications, Owner Contract, subcontracts, purchase orders, daily correspondence, drawings, submittals, and all other project related documents and maintain a complete and accurate set of as-built drawings Estimating experience, a plus Able to work under pressure and coordinate numerous activities and groups of people who need to cooperate to achieve maximum efficiency Self-motivated with skills to motivate others Strong verbal and written communication skills Strong computer skills. Physical Requirements Prolonged periods sitting at a desk and working on a computer. Ability to stand for extended periods of time. Ability to walk the property and laydown yards. Ability to carry up to 50 pounds.
